What are managed antivirus services?

Antivirus software helps you find and eliminate malware threats on your computers and network. The antivirus software company collects new data about threats and builds a virus database so that your software is always alert to the latest problems. This approach is called unmanaged antivirus protection because you can still deny updates, remove the antivirus software, or just stop its functions.

A managed antivirus is remotely controlled by IT experts who take care of the service for you. The IT professionals will install the software; which updates automatically, runs pre-scheduled scans, and those results are professionally analyzed. If any serious infections arise the IT expert can take immediate action to resolve it. 

Your employees don’t have to do anything as the entire process is fully automated behind the scenes. It’s one less thing to worry about, but it’s a big relief since a virus could be catastrophic for your business.

 

Why companies need managed antivirus protection

Hackers use malware attacks to relentlessly attack businesses. That’s a fact. While you can’t control the amount of attacks, the right managed antivirus protection big you peace of mind in the following ways: 

  • Same level of security on all systems

Managed antivirus software implements the same level of security on all of the systems in a business. When all systems on your network have the same level of security, it is easier to update and manage them. When you apply for a managed service from an IT provider, they take the responsibility to implement the same security measures on each and every computer. So whenever a new policy is defined or a new system is introduced, the same level of security is upgraded on each system.

The result is that the managed antivirus software provider ensures that all the systems are secured through this software and none of them is unprotected. Whenever a new update arrives, it is installed on every computer for added security.

  • Cost-effective solutions

What many small business owners don’t know is that managed antivirus software is actually cheaper than the cost of buying antivirus software for the whole company, not to mention the time savings for you when you have a professional managing it behind the scenes. 

This is because managed antivirus software comes with monthly packages and your entire company is considered a single user. Alternatively, when purchasing antivirus software you need to pay individually for each system. Why not go with the more cost-effective option that includes staff to manage and update your systems regularly while saving you money overall?

  • Continuous detection

As a result of continuous upgrades and installing updates, your business will enjoy greater security and protection. IT providers and technicians for managed antivirus software ensure the complete security of your business systems, not just by continuous monitoring but by continuous detection as well. 

Whenever an unauthorized user attempts to access your confidential data, the managed antivirus software immediately recognizes this suspicious activity. Not only do they block or restrict illegal and unauthorized access, they also block the fraudulent user and send alert notification to your in-house IT techs so that they can implement any other security solutions you might want.

In contrast, without managed antivirus you won’t get alerts or notifications of suspicious activity, leaving you vulnerable to attacks that you may not be aware of until it’s too late.
